Synopsys Inc has an operating margin of 13.0%, meaning the company retains $13 of operating profit per $100 of revenue. This strong profitability earns a score of 65/100, reflecting efficient cost management and pricing power. This is down from 22.1% the prior year.
Synopsys Inc's revenue surged 15.1% year-over-year to $7.1B, reflecting rapid business expansion. This strong growth earns a score of 72/100.
Synopsys Inc carries a low D/E ratio of 0.48, meaning only $0.48 of long-term debt for every $1 of shareholders' equity. This conservative leverage earns a score of 94/100, indicating a strong balance sheet with room for future borrowing.
Synopsys Inc's current ratio of 1.62 indicates adequate short-term liquidity, earning a score of 45/100. The company can meet its near-term obligations, though with limited headroom.
Synopsys Inc converts 19.1% of revenue into free cash flow ($1.3B). This strong cash generation earns a score of 96/100.
Synopsys Inc generates a 4.7% ROE, indicating limited profit relative to shareholders' investment. This results in a returns score of 19/100. This is down from 24.3% the prior year.
Synopsys Inc scores 3.09, well above the 2.99 safe threshold. The score is driven primarily by a large market capitalization ($83.6B) relative to total liabilities ($19.9B). This indicates low bankruptcy risk based on profitability, leverage, and asset efficiency.
Synopsys Inc passes 3 of 9 financial strength tests. 3 of 4 profitability signals pass, no leverage/liquidity signals pass (rising debt, declining liquidity, or share dilution), neither operating efficiency signal passes.
For every $1 of reported earnings, Synopsys Inc generates $1.14 in operating cash flow ($1.5B OCF vs $1.3B net income). This indicates profits are well-supported by actual cash generation, not accounting adjustments.
Synopsys Inc earns $2.0 in operating income for every $1 of interest expense ($914.9M vs $446.7M). This adequate coverage means the company can meet its interest obligations, but has limited cushion if earnings fall.

What is Synopsys Inc's Altman Z-Score?
Synopsys Inc (SNPS) has an Altman Z-Score of 3.09, placing it in the Safe Zone (low bankruptcy risk). The Z-Score combines five financial ratios—working capital, retained earnings, EBIT, market capitalization, and revenue relative to total assets—to predict the likelihood of bankruptcy. Scores above 2.99 indicate financial safety while scores below 1.81 suggest financial distress. Learn more in our complete guide to financial health indicators.
What is Synopsys Inc's Piotroski F-Score?
Synopsys Inc (SNPS) has a Piotroski F-Score of 3 out of 9, indicating weak financial health. The F-Score evaluates nine binary signals across profitability (positive ROA, positive cash flow, improving ROA, earnings quality), leverage (decreasing debt, improving liquidity, no share dilution), and operating efficiency (improving gross margin, improving asset turnover). Scores of 7–9 indicate strong and improving fundamentals. Learn more in our complete guide to financial health indicators.
Are Synopsys Inc's earnings high quality?
Synopsys Inc (SNPS) has an earnings quality ratio of 1.14x, considered cash-backed (high quality). This ratio compares operating cash flow to net income. A ratio above 1.0x means the company generates more cash than its reported earnings, indicating sustainable, cash-backed profits. Ratios below 1.0x suggest earnings rely on accounting accruals rather than actual cash generation. Learn more in our complete guide to financial health indicators.
